Algoritimo
Tese: Algoritimo. Pesquise 862.000+ trabalhos acadêmicosPor: pamela27 • 7/10/2014 • Tese • 631 Palavras (3 Páginas) • 250 Visualizações
Introdução
O problema proposto nos pede para elaborar um algoritmo que resolva o problema de uma empresa. Ela precisa de um programa que faça a conversão de moedas, de reais para franco, euro e libra esterlina.
O primeiro passo é identificar os dados de entrada do problema, os processamentos necessários para encontrar o que é pedido e os dados de saída. Usando essas informações, deveremos elaborar um algoritmo em descrição narrativa, em pseudocódigo e em fluxograma.
Os dados de entrada do problema são:
a) Moeda a qual possuímos que é real
b) Moeda qual desejamos fazer a conversão, que é o franco, euro e libra esterlina.
c) O calculo necessário para a conversão.
A cotação das moedas foi realizada no dia 01/09/2014.
Cotação do franco = 2,43
Cotação do euro = 2,94
Cotação da libra esterlina = 3,71
a) Reais* 2,43 = Franco
b) Reais*2,94 = Euro
c) Reais*3,71 = Libra esterlina
Os dados de saída do problema, serão conforme a escolha do usuário. Ou será em franco, ou em euros, ou em libra esterlina. Com esses dados em mãos conseguimos fazer o algoritmo em descrição narrativa.
Para o passo dois, temos que apresentar um algoritmo completo para a conversão das três moedas para o real. Sendo assim, o usuário do programa devera digitar a quantia em reais e o programa devolvera resposta com os devidos valores nas três moedas.
Algoritmo- conversor de moedas apresentação em linguagem “c”
#include<iostream>
Int main(int argc,char*argcv[])
char DATA[10];
printf(“PROGRAMA PARA CONVERSAO DE MOEDAS #\n\n”);
printf(“ENTRE COM O VALOR EM REAIS R$”);
scanf(“%f”,&R$);
printf(“ENTRE COM A TAXA DE FRANCO FHC”);
scanf(“%f”,&FHC);
printf(“ENTRE COM A TAXA DO EURO EU$”);
scanf(“%F”,& EU$);
printf(“ENTRE COM A TAXA DA LIBRA ESTERLINA £$”)
scanf(“%f”,&£);
printf(“ENTRE COM A DATA DA COTAÇAO 01/09/14:”)
scanf(“%s”DATA);
printf(“\n VALOR DO FRANCO FRENTE AO REAL E: FCH%.2f\n”,R*FHC);
printf(“VALOR DO EURO FRENTE AO REAL E: EU$%.2f\n”,R*EU);
printf(“VALOR DA LIBRA ESTERLINA FRENTE AO REAL E: £$%.2f\n”,R*£$);
printf(“DATA DA COTAÇAO E: %s\n”, DATA);
system(“PAUSE”);
return 0;
}
Fim
O algoritmo em pseudocódigos para a resolução deste problema ficara de forma que o usuário entre com um valor em reais R$ e seja convertido para franco FHC. Fica assim:
Algoritmo – Conversor de moedas apresentação em “pseudocódigo”
Inicio
Escrever (“quantos reais você tem”)
Ler (“reais”)
Escrever (“você tem
...